Alright, this really sucks. I have a machine w/ XP Pro
(SP1) that is full of encrypted files using EFS. The guy
using the computer doesn't work here anymore and failed to
give the password. I went into the Admin account and
changed his password so I could get into the account,
completely forgetting that the change of password would
render the private key useless. Nothing has been deleted
or changed other than the account password. Is there any
way I can recover these encrypted files and have access to
them again? I appreciate it.

Contact the employee and reset the password to original.
Otherwise study thoroughly the information on the bottom of this page
to help prevent this again:
http://www3.telus.net/dandemar/encrypt.htm

EFS is very good at keeping data from unauthorized users and to EFS
you are unauthorized.
